Network analysis for GPS UTMnav system: preliminary stage
This ongoing research concentrates on the network analysis of the existing UTM navigation system (UTMnav). The aim is to overcome the limitation of UTMnav system in network analysis. A few shortest-path algorithms have been studied namely Dijkstra's, Floyd Warshall and A-Star (A*). Each algorit...
